E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Android缓存
Odoo性能优化
以下是基于实际项目经验总结的具体方法和最佳实践,涵盖数据库、代码、视图、
缓存
等多个层面:️一、数据库优化索引策略合理创建索引:对频繁查询的字段(如日期、状态字段)添加index=True,但避免过度索引导致写操作变慢
·
2025-07-24 17:11
用 Dagger2 实现
Android
依赖注入最佳实践
引言随着移动应用规模和复杂度的不断提升,开发者面临着日益增长的依赖管理难题。传统的手动实例化和依赖传递方法不仅导致样板代码膨胀,而且容易引发难以排查的耦合问题和潜在的内存泄露。依赖注入(DependencyInjection,DI)作为一种反转控制(InversionofControl,IoC)模式,通过将组件的构造与使用分离,实现了高度的模块解耦和可测试性。Dagger2作为Google推出的编
金枝玉叶9
·
2025-07-24 14:21
程序员知识储备1
程序员知识储备2
程序员知识储备3
算法
机器学习
人工智能
数学建模
数据库
高并发场景下的
缓存
问题与一致性解决方案(技术方案总结)
高并发场景下的
缓存
问题与一致性解决方案(技术方案总结)1.引言在高并发系统中,
缓存
是提升性能的关键组件,但不当的
缓存
使用可能导致
缓存
穿透、雪崩、击穿等问题,同时
缓存
与数据库的数据一致性也是常见挑战。
遥不可及~~斌
·
2025-07-24 14:21
缓存
Hugging Face 模型的
缓存
和直接下载有什么区别?
HuggingFace模型的
缓存
和直接下载(下载到本地文件夹)是两种不同的模型管理方式,它们在使用场景、存储结构和效率上各有优劣。
SugarPPig
·
2025-07-24 14:49
人工智能
缓存
人工智能
Android
用户鉴权实现方案深度分析
用户鉴权是确认“用户是谁”的过程,是保障应用数据安全和用户隐私的基石。选择合适的方案需要综合考虑安全性、用户体验、开发复杂度、后端支持等因素。核心目标:安全确认用户身份:防止未授权访问。保护用户凭证:安全存储和传输密码、令牌等敏感信息。管理会话:在用户登录后维持其身份状态,并在适当时机安全终止。良好的用户体验:登录流程顺畅,支持生物识别、自动登录等便利功能。兼容性与标准:遵循行业最佳实践和安全标准
你过来啊你
·
2025-07-24 14:18
android
鉴权
力扣146题:LRU
缓存
力扣146题:LRU
缓存
题目描述请你设计并实现一个满足LRU(最近最少使用)
缓存
约束的数据结构。
瀛台夜雪
·
2025-07-24 13:16
力扣刷题
leetcode
缓存
数据结构
AI创作系列第22篇:前端
缓存
与更新机制重构 - 表情包系统的全面升级
AI创作系列第22篇:前端
缓存
与更新机制重构-表情包系统的全面升级本文是海狸IMAI创作系列的第22篇文章,详细介绍前端
缓存
系统的重构和表情包功能的全面升级。
「、皓子~
·
2025-07-24 13:45
前端
缓存
重构
IM
社交软件
开源软件
uniapp
mybatis多对一一对多的关联及拼接操作以及
缓存
处理
1、多对一:简单的说,就是将查询出来的多个结果分别赋予另一个结果的三个属性多对一关联:①创建对象,添加属性(这里不再展示config.xml文件连接数据库,这是每一个项目必备的)@DatapublicclassEmp{privateIntegerempNo;privateStringename;privateStringjob;privateIntegermgr;privateStringhire
·
2025-07-24 13:14
pip关于
缓存
的用法
pipcacheinfo查看pip
缓存
的大小,运行示例Packageindexpagecachelocation(pipv23.3+):c:\users\xxx\appdata\local\pip\cache
lagrahhn
·
2025-07-24 13:13
pip
缓存
如何用keepAlive实现标签页
缓存
什么是KeepAlive首先,要明确所说的是TCP的KeepAlive还是HTTP的Keep-Alive。TCP的KeepAlive和HTTP的Keep-Alive是完全不同的概念,不能混为一谈。实际上HTTP的KeepAlive写法是Keep-Alive,跟TCP的KeepAlive写法上也有不同。TCP的KeepAliveTCP的KeepAlive是侧重在保持客户端和服务端的连接,一方会不定期
It's Leah
·
2025-07-24 13:13
网络
tcp/ip
网络协议
2024.12软考-高级系统架构师-真题回忆
案例二数据库cache-aside【问答题】(1)填空流程图说明
缓存
读写的过程。(2)填空流程图说明写
缓存
的过程(3)回答问题,线程1负责写数
vidi19
·
2025-07-24 13:12
系统架构
架构师--
缓存
场景
从程序员到架构师——
缓存
层场景-CSDN博客读
缓存
业务场景如何将十几秒的查询请求优化成毫秒级?这次项目针对的系统是一个电商系统。每个电商系统都有个商品详情页。
小裕哥略帅
·
2025-07-24 12:09
面试笔记
java
如何在 Ubuntu 20.04 Linux 上安装 TeamSpeak 客户端
TeamSpeak是一款可在Linux、Windows、macOS、FreeBSD和
Android
上安装的免费语音会议软件。它是类似Discord等其他平台的先驱。
·
2025-07-24 12:05
C#/PixUI 应用在微信小程序中的 WebAssembly 集成方案
Android
真机运行效果:[此处建议补充具体效果描述或截图]模拟器运行效果:[此处建议补充具体效果描述或截图]二、实现原理核心原理如下图所示:[示意图位置-建议补充图示]将C#编写的PixUI应用及C
bpluo42657
·
2025-07-24 11:30
c#
微信小程序
wasm
【
Android
】用 ViewPager2 + Fragment + TabLayout 实现标签页切换
文章目录【
Android
】用ViewPager2+Fragment+TabLayout实现标签页切换一、引入:什么是ViewPager2?
LiuYaoheng
·
2025-07-24 11:59
android
学习
java
笔记
RK3588
Android
12 自定义HAL服务到上层app
背景:荣品开发板RD-rk3588sdk不支持编译app源码,所以只能将jar包导入到上层app中实现提取jar包#进入目录cdout/target/common/obj/JAVA_LIBRARIES/framework-minus-apex_intermediates#查看classes.jar有没有我们的classjar-tfclasses.jar#解压出helloworldManager.c
Kellen Lin
·
2025-07-24 11:29
RK3588
Android12
系统驱动开发
android
java
开发语言
arm开发
驱动开发
rk3588
Android
12 添加framework层服务,HAL库,从硬件驱动层到上层APP,实现led灯控
系列文章目录rk3588
Android
12添加framework层服务,HAL库,从硬件驱动层到上层APP,实现led灯控文章目录系列文章目录一、驱动适配:1.设备树2.设置文件权限3、开启CONFIG_LEDS_PWM
·
2025-07-24 11:29
Android
Camera openCamera
由头今日调休,终于终于闲下来了,可以写一下博客了,刚好打开自己电脑,就有四年前下的谷歌
Android
12源码,不是很旧,刚好够用,不用再另外下载新源码了,不得不感慨这时间过得真快啊~废话不多说,开整!
星空梦想plus
·
2025-07-24 10:25
我与相机
android
相机
error: GLES2/gl2.h: No such file or directory
最近一个朋友让帮忙编译
android
程序,中间遇到了很多问题,大概都解决了。
写点自己想写的
·
2025-07-24 10:55
android
ndk
mina网络通信框架在
Android
开发中的实战应用
本套件提供了mina在
Android
端的核心组件和模块,以及使用mina实现的
Android
应用案例,包括服务端和客户端的通信实例。
·
2025-07-24 10:51
Android
开发布局系列: LinearLayout布局实现垂直水平居中
1、
android
:orientation="vertical"表示该布局下的元素垂直排列2、
android
:layout_gravity="center_horizontal"表示该布局在父布局里水平居中
hayhead
·
2025-07-24 08:42
布局
Android
android
从理论到实践:
缓存
策略与负载均衡如何优化电商API接口性能
电商API接口性能优化:
缓存
策略与负载均衡实践在电商领域,API接口作为连接前端应用与后端服务的关键纽带,其性能直接影响到用户体验、系统稳定性及业务运营效率。
Joe13265449558
·
2025-07-24 08:12
API
京东
返回值
接口
淘宝
天猫
动态度量 linux,扩展Linux完整性度量IMA/EVM到
Android
1.完整性度量概述运行时的系统完整性由系统的访问控制机制保证,如DAC(DiscreteAccessControl,间接访问控制)/MAC(MandatoryAccessControl,强制访问控制,如SELinux,Smack)。DAC/MAC无法检测文件的离线修改;加密文件系统可以保护非法访问,但开销大,效率相对较低。完整性度量,将文件内容和文件的属性/扩展属性,通过加密哈希生成对应的ima/
weixin_39926540
·
2025-07-24 08:09
动态度量
linux
扩展Linux完整性度量IMA/EVM到
Android
1.完整性度量概述运行时的系统完整性由系统的访问控制机制保证,如DAC(DiscreteAccessControl,间接访问控制)/MAC(MandatoryAccessControl,强制访问控制,如SELinux,Smack)。DAC/MAC无法检测文件的离线修改;加密文件系统可以保护非法访问,但开销大,效率相对较低。完整性度量,将文件内容和文件的属性/扩展属性,通过加密哈希生成对应的ima/
·
2025-07-24 08:07
京东返利 APP 千万级用户架构案例:
缓存
穿透、雪崩解决方案与流量调度策略
京东返利APP千万级用户架构案例:
缓存
穿透、雪崩解决方案与流量调度策略大家好,我是阿可,微赚淘客系统及省赚客APP创始人,是个冬天不穿秋裤,天冷也要风度的程序猿!
微赚淘客系统@聚娃科技
·
2025-07-24 07:33
架构
缓存
spring
获取
android
设备模拟器名称
adbdevices(base)PSE:\
Android
studioproject\tvandphone>adb-semulator-5554shellgetpropro.product.modelsdk_gphone64
·
2025-07-24 07:03
【C++进阶】揭秘list迭代器:从底层实现到极致优化
目录一、迭代器:list的灵魂纽带二、list迭代器的底层实现1.节点结构设计2.迭代器核心实现三、关键优化技术1.内联函数优化2.循环展开优化3.尾节点
缓存
优化四、迭代器失效的雷区五、性能对比实验六、
TravisBytes
·
2025-07-24 05:19
编程问题档案
c++
list
开发语言
npm报错npm ERR! A complete log of this run can be found in
网上有很多解决的办法,有的是删除node_modules从新npminstall.还有的解决办法是删除npm的
缓存
,但是这个报错还有一种根本性的原因–node版本太低,如果node的版本太低,而项目需求的版本较高
leese233
·
2025-07-24 03:35
1024程序员节
Android
Gson复杂数据结构(如Map、List)的序列化逻辑原理剖析
一、复杂数据结构序列化概述1.1复杂数据结构处理的重要性在
Android
开发中,JSON数据往往包含复杂数据结构,如Map、List等。
·
2025-07-24 02:32
深入理解 UniApp:跨平台开发的终极解决方案
传统开发模式下,针对iOS、
Android
、微信小程序、H5等不同平台需要编写多套代码,开发成本高且维护困难。DCloud公司于2019年推出的UniApp,正是为了解决这一行业痛点而生。
·
2025-07-24 02:02
uni-app跨平台开发知识点总结
uni-app简介uni-app概述:uni-app是一个使用Vue.js开发所有前端应用的框架,开发者编写一套代码,可发布到iOS、
Android
、Web(响应式)、以及各种小程序(微信/支付宝/百度
·
2025-07-24 02:31
ASP.NET Core MVC Redis
缓存
应用
环境:ASP.NETCoreMVC,Redis-Win-x64-3.2.100本文介绍在ASP.NETCoreMVC中怎么用Redis
缓存
数据。
郑小晨
·
2025-07-24 02:29
.NET
Redis
ASP.NET
Core
缓存
.net core session 存储到redis
缓存
数据库
1.Startup.cs文件ConfigureServices方法加入以下代码#region使用Redis保存SessionvarredisConn=Configuration["WebConfig:Redis:Connection"];varredisInstanceName=Configuration["WebConfig:Redis:InstanceName"];//Session过期时长分
·
2025-07-24 02:58
【ASP.NET Core】内存
缓存
(MemoryCache)原理、应用及常见问题解析
系列文章目录链接:【ASP.NETCore】REST与RESTful详解,从理论到实现链接:【ASP.NETCore】深入理解Controller的工作机制文章目录系列文章目录前言一、ASP.NETCore中的内存
缓存
ArabySide
·
2025-07-24 02:57
#
ASP.NET
Core
asp.net
缓存
后端
asp.net
core
c#
【ASP.NET Core】ASP.NET Core中Redis分布式
缓存
的应用
系列文章目录链接:【ASP.NETCore】REST与RESTful详解,从理论到实现链接:【ASP.NETCore】深入理解Controller的工作机制链接:【ASP.NETCore】内存
缓存
(MemoryCache
ArabySide
·
2025-07-24 02:57
#
.NET
Core
Redis
缓存
redis
分布式缓存
asp.net
asp.net
core
三分钟集成 Tap 防沉迷 SDK(Unity 版)
弹窗提示开发环境要求:Unity2019.4或更高版本iOS10或更高版本
Android
5.0(APIlevel21)或更高版本Unity集成Demo参考链接UnityTap
暮知秋
·
2025-07-24 01:45
解决幽默【VmmenWSA】占用系统资源过高且无法直接结束进程办法
出现原因VmmemWSA是与WindowsSubsystemfor
Android
(WSA)相关的进程。当尝试关
鱼圆食不食
·
2025-07-24 00:15
windows
关于ios点击分享自动复制到粘贴板的问题
前言
Android
系统没有什么特别的要求,实现这个也比较容易。但ios在某些情况下就会出现问题。
·
2025-07-23 23:08
《Integer
缓存
池原理及应用》
1.通过代码说明Integer
缓存
池的存在在Java中,Integer类有一个
缓存
池机制,用于
缓存
一定范围内的Integer对象。
猿究院--王升
·
2025-07-23 22:33
缓存
java
servlet
python+playwright 学习-91 cookies的获取保存删除相关操作
前言playwright可以获取浏览器
缓存
的cookie信息,可以将这些cookies信息保存到本地,还可以加载本地cookies。
上海-悠悠
·
2025-07-23 21:57
playwright
python
Java学习----Redis集群
在分布式系统开发中,Redis作为高性能的键值存储数据库,被广泛用于
缓存
、会话存储、消息队列等场景。
典孝赢麻崩乐急
·
2025-07-23 19:46
java
学习
redis
ELF文件解析
ELF文件解析近期正在进行
Android
的逆向。自己写出好代码是一个方面,而破解别人的代码则会给人另一种感受。
涌进的小羔羊
·
2025-07-23 18:10
Android逆向
android
c++
ELF
解析
MySQL存储引擎核心:了解Buffer Pool与Page管理机制
MySQL存储引擎核心:了解BufferPool与Page管理机制1.BufferPool:数据库的高速
缓存
1.1基本概念作用:
缓存
表数据与索引数据,减少磁盘IO组成:
缓存
数据页(Page,默认16KB
hdzw20
·
2025-07-23 18:06
mysql
数据库
Android
bootanimation动画制作和验证
Android
开机动画使用bootanimation程序显示开机画面,只需按格式要求做bootanimation.zip包,放在系统的/system/media目录中。
小姜的android之旅
·
2025-07-23 17:36
Android
bootanimation
bootanimation
Flutter(二十三)编译模式
Flutter编译模式在
Android
和iOS中,应用程序运行分为debug和release模式,分别对应调试阶段和发布阶段;在Flutter中,应用程序分为以下三种模式1.debug2.profile3
AlanGe
·
2025-07-23 17:27
instantiate 卡顿严重_Unity3D研究院之利用
缓存
池解决Instantiate慢的问题(七十三)...
Unity3D做项目有三个地方处理不好游戏整体就会出现卡顿的问题。2.角色放技能的时候卡尤其是放群体攻击技能时,因为每个人身上都要产生一个技能特效。技能都是用粒子特效做的,虽然Unity中粒子特效也是一个GameObject.但是ParticleSystem这个组件太特殊了。Instantiate以后会自动的执行脚本的初始化工作,ParticleSystem组件肯定也是个脚本,虽然我们看不到它实现
weixin_39992312
·
2025-07-23 17:29
instantiate
卡顿严重
instantiate 卡顿严重_利用
缓存
池解决Instantiate慢的问题
Unity3D做项目有三个地方处理不好游戏整体就会出现卡顿的问题。1.NGUI直接打开界面卡,建议看看这一篇文章http://www.xuanyusong.com/archives/2799(本文就不赘述了)2.角色放技能的时候卡尤其是放群体攻击技能时,因为每个人身上都要产生一个技能特效。技能都是用粒子特效做的,虽然Unity中粒子特效也是一个GameObject.但是ParticleSystem
weixin_39958100
·
2025-07-23 17:59
instantiate
卡顿严重
Android
UI 组件系列(五):CheckBox、RadioButton 与 Switch 控件详解
博客专栏:
Android
初级入门UI组件与布局源码:通过网盘分享的文件:
Android
入门布局及UI相关案例链接:https://pan.baidu.com/s/1EOuDUKJndMISolieFSvXXg
·
2025-07-23 16:54
RK3588 编译
Android
13 镜像方法
下载
Android
SDK源代码#下载完成后,在解压前先校验下MD5码:$md5sum-c
android
*.txt
android
*_rk35xx_*_sdk.tar.gzaa:OK
android
*_rk35xx
YOYO--小天
·
2025-07-23 16:53
RK35XX学习
android
linux
java开发安卓和kotlin对比
Java和Kotlin都是用于
Android
开发的编程语言,它们各自具有独特的特点和优势。
哈哈皮皮虾的皮
·
2025-07-23 16:53
java
android
kotlin
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他